One year ago, Yuta lost his father from a car accident. Now in the 6th grade, Yuta goes to catch a beetle at a damn on a deep mountain. Yuta often went there with his father. There, Yuta meets a strange old man. Due to heavy rain, Yuta slips and falls down a bridge. He becomes unconscious. When Yuta awakes, he see a child Saeko in front of him. Saeko takes Yuta to a village that looks like something that existed 30 years ago.
